- Erros de gravaçãoAlthough referred to as a Schooner, it would be more correctly called a Cutter Rigged Ketch. The mizzen mast is shorter than the main mast, as well as being forward of the rudder post, and there are two roller furling jobs (one that extends to the top of the main mast, one that does not).
